  • there was no H.O in 91 the 305 5.0 H>O motor was a l69 carb 305. 91 fbodys could only get l03 tbi 5.0 or 2 different LB9 305 tpi motors

  • truth.

    engines for 91 were the

    3.1/LB9/L98

    v6/305/350--->for who doesnt know gm engine names

  • The 305TPI motor was considered the HO 305 motor for later years.

  • 91 Trans Am 5L H.O. 5-Speed?? IMPOSSIBEL!!! why? the year with the following engines. 1991: 3.1L Multi-port Fuel Injection, 5.0L Throttle Body Injection, 5.0L Tuned Port Injection, 5.7L Tuned Port Injection. he could have swaped the engine.. but from factory, that option was gone some long ago! one thing.. LS1/T56 vs. L69 (V8 5L H.O)/T5?? i know the H.O is a box of surprises, but the T5 would not handle an high modefied H.O V8. its a weak transmission for so much power. prob he has an TKO..

  • ps- last year for the 5.0L 4-barrel H.O. (5-speed only) was 1986.. hope this is a good help to figure out this trans am ;)
